Michael Workéyè trained at the prestigious Arts Educational Schools London on a DaDa scholarship, graduating with a first-class degree and delivering the student address at his ceremony. During his training, he received the Lilian Baylis Award and was shortlisted for the Spotlight Prize, for which he wrote his own monologue—securing representation with Olivia Bell Management.
Michael’s screen debut included roles in the BAFTA-winning Sitting in Limbo and opposite Ben Whishaw and Ambika Mod in BBC’s This Is Going to Hurt. In 2022, he gave a breakout performance in Beru Tessema’s House of Ife at the Bush Theatre, directed by Lynette Linton, earning nominations for both an Offie and the Stage Debut Award.
Spotted in that production by casting director Kate Rhodes James, Michael was cast as Archer in Amazon Prime’s period comedy My Lady Jane, which received critical acclaim and a 94% rating on Rotten Tomatoes.
His stage work includes Shed, the Bruntwood Award-winning play by Phoebe Eclair-Powell at the Royal Exchange, and from July 2025, he stars as Kevin in Paldem the Play by David Jonsson.
On screen, Michael recently appeared in Black Mirror (Netflix, Season 7), Disney+ thriller Playdate alongside Ambika Mod, Jim Sturgess, Denise Gough, and Holliday Grainger, and the series The Stolen Girl. He stars in Duncan Jones' upcoming motion-capture film Rogue Trooper and plays Billy Fox in the 1940s CBS drama Bookish with Mark Gatiss. He also wrapped filming The Girlfriend, opposite Robin Wright for Amazon Prime Video.
Currently, Michael is filming BBC’s Inspector Lynley as DC Tony Bekele in Dublin, and appearing in Margo’s Got Money Troubles with Elle Fanning, Michelle Pfeiffer, and Nicole Kidman, as well as Charli XCX: The Moment.
